This is a Smith-Victor RS10 10' Heavy Duty Aluminum Light Stand with 5/8 Top Mount. Raven aluminum light stands are lightweight and built to last. Tubular bases with wide footprint diameters provide ample support for your lighting equipment.
| Minimum Height | 32 in (81 cm) |
| Maximum Height | 10 ft (3 M) |
| Closed Length | 32 in (81 cm) |
| Footprint Diameter | 4 ft (1.2 M) |
| Weight | 3 lbs (1.4 kg) |
| Maximum Load | Not specified by manufacturer |
| Attachment Size | 5/8 in male stud |
| Accepts Wheels | Yes- (401272) |
| Air Cushioned | No |

Extends to 9 1/2 feet, sturdy, easily adjustable and is surprisingly light weight. It has a 5/8-inch stud post and built-in 1/4x20 screw thread on top with plastic protector. Seems "elegant." I bough four of these and glad I chose this model for my location setups.
